  • Coffee biz gives ex-cons a new lease on life

    The Wheaton Sun – Mon Nov 9, 2:09 am ET  

    Starting a business isn't easy these days. And it might be a little harder if an entrepreneur purposely seeks employees who have been recently released from prison. But the post-prison experience is central to Pete Leonard's business plan for the Second Chance Coffee Company at 657 Childs St. in Wheaton. Full Story »
